Causes The main reasons are damage to the cervix, cardinal cervical ligament and uterosacral ligament caused by delivery and failure of supporting tissues to return to normal after delivery. In addition, most women in the postpartum period like to lie on their backs and are prone to chronic urinary retention. The uterus is prone to become posterior, with the axis of the uterus in the same direction as the axis of the vagina. When the abdominal pressure increases, the uterus will descend along the direction of the vagina and prolapse will occur. Postpartum squatting (such as washing diapers, washing vegetables, etc.) can increase abdominal pressure and cause uterine prolapse. Uterine prolapse in nulliparous women is caused by poor development of the supporting tissues of the reproductive organs. examine Instruct the patient not to urinate and assume the lithotomy position. During the examination, the patient is first asked to cough or exhale to increase abdominal pressure, and observe whether urine overflows from the urethra to determine whether there is stress urinary incontinence. The bladder is then emptied and a gynecological examination is performed. First, pay attention to vaginal wall prolapse and uterine prolapse without exerting force. And pay attention to the condition of the vulva and the degree of perineal rupture. Use a vaginal speculum to observe whether the vaginal wall and cervix are ulcerated, and whether there is rectouterine hernia. During internal examination, attention should be paid to the condition of the anal levator muscles on both sides, the width of the anal levator muscle fissure, the position of the cervix, and then the size of the uterus, its position in the pelvic cavity, and whether there is inflammation or tumor in the appendages. Finally, the patient is advised to apply abdominal pressure and, if necessary, squat to make the uterus prolapse and then perform palpation to determine the extent of uterine prolapse.
